hullo off to Madrid at the weekend for a shopping spree, and wondered if fellow basenoter's could recommend some perfumeria's? information on large stockists to specialist stores would be much appreciated, and save me time wandering around cluelessly! much obliged. Tommy Answer: Barfumeria Conde de Aranda nr 4 28001 Madrid Nadia Velasquez nr 46 28001 Madrid Paris Guzman El bueno 106 28003 Madrid RAMAS C/Velasquez nr 45 28006 Madrid Velas y Decoration Claudio Coello nr 69 bis 28001 Madrid These perfumeries are listed on L'Artisan website and I suppose that if they stock L'Artisan they must have other brands too. Answer: Originally Posted by Eluard Now that you guys are watching this thread, I wanted to ask you what Spanish colognes are most popular in Spain at the moment? I guess the best way to answer that question is with statistical data. These are the male and female top five of 2006: Male: 1 Le Male - Jean Paul Gaultier (BPI) 4,60% 2 Acqua di Gio - Giorgio Armani (L'Oréal) 3,90% 3 Esencia - Loewe (LVMH) 3,80% 4 Agua Fresca - Adolfo Domínguez (Puig) 3,70% 5 Boss Bottled - Hugo Boss (P&G) 3,40% Female: 1 Eau de Rochas (P&G) 3,80% 2 Agua Fresca - Adolfo Domínguez (Puig) 2,60% 3 Aire - Loewe (LVMH) 2% 4 CK One - Calvin Klein (Coty) 1,90% 5 Amor Amor - Cacharel (L'Oréal ) 1,90% I believe only Loewe and Adolfo Domínguez are Spanish brands, although that is a hard thing to determine these days of multinational companies.
